草庐IT

串并联

全部标签

ios - 拆分属性字符串并保留格式

如何将现有的NSAttributedString根据预定义的分隔符进行划分,同时保持格式不变?componentsSeparatedByString似乎不会对NSAttributedString进行操作。我当前的解决方法在正确的点生成拆分,但只输出一个NSString。从而丢失格式。NSData*rtfFileData=[NSDatadataWithContentsOfFile:path];NSAttributedString*rtfFileAttributedString=[[NSAttributedStringalloc]initWithData:rtfFileDataoption

【时间日期转换】将日期或者时间戳转换成指定格式的字符串并指定时区(Scala实现)

/***Formatsatimeinmillisecondsintoaspecificpatterninatimezone.**@parammillisthetimeexpressedinmilliseconds*@parampatternthepatterntousetoformatthedate*@paramtimeZoneIdthetime-zoneID*/defformatTimeMillis(millis:Long,pattern:String="yyyy-MM-ddHH:mm:ss",timeZoneId:String=TimeZone.getDefault.getID)={val

浅谈一下 电路LC串并联谐振(电容,电感)的知识

聊聊谐振        新人博主欢迎关注,以下是根据我已有的知识进行的回答,本人才疏学浅,答案中肯定存在不精确不完善之处,请对此问题有更深刻理解的专家进行更专业的讲解,或对我的进行修正。 什么是谐振   共振:物体有自己的固有频率,当外来振动频率与固有频率相同时,会产生最强的振动。什么是LC谐振电路?    概念:对于包含电容和电感及电阻元件的无源一端口网络,其端口可能呈现容性、感性及电阻性。当电路端口的电压U和电流I出现同相位时,电路呈现电阻特性,称为谐振现象,这样的电路称为谐振电路。最简单的谐振电路就是一阶LC谐振电路,只由一个电感、一个电容和信号源组成。简单来说,电路中的阻抗只有电阻时,

java - 如何在 Java 中拆分字符串并保留分隔符?

我有这个字符串(Java1.5)::alpha;beta:gamma;delta我需要一个数组:{":alpha",";beta",":gamma",";delta"}在Java中最方便的方法是什么? 最佳答案 str.split("(?=[:;])")这将为您提供所需的数组,只有第一项为空。并且:str.split("(?=\\b[:;])")这将给出没有空第一项的数组。这里的关键是(?=X),它是一个零宽度正先行(非捕获构造)(参见regexpatterndocs)。[:;]表示“要么;要么:”\b是单词边界-它的存在是为了不将

FPGA配置文件从串并模式下载

FPGA配置文件的下载模式有5种:主串模式(masterserial)从串模式(slaveserial)主并模式(masterselectMAP)从并模式(slaveselectMAP)JTAG模式  其中,JTAG模式在开发调试阶段使用。其余四种下载模式,可分为串行下载方式和并行下载方式。串行下载方式和并行下载方式都有主、从2种模式。  主、从模式的最大区别在于:主模式的下载同步时钟(CCLK)由FPGA提供;从模式的下载同步时钟(CCLK)由外部时钟源或者外部控制信号提供。  主模式对下载时序的要求比从模式严格得多,因此一般选择使用从串模式或从并模式。一、从串模式在从串模式下,加载FPGA

python - 如何解析 numpydoc 文档字符串并访问组件?

我想解析一个numpydoc文档字符串并以编程方式访问每个组件。例如:deffoobar(a,b):'''SomethingsomethingParameters----------a:int,default:5Doessomethingcoolb:strWow'''我想做的是:parsed=magic_parser(foobar)parsed.text#Somethingsomethingparsed.a.text#Doessomethingcoolparsed.a.type#intparsed.a.default#5我一直在四处搜索,发现了类似numpydoc的东西和napoleo

python - 如何将 timedelta 转换为字符串并再次返回

Dateutil的timedelta对象似乎有一个自定义的__str__方法:In[1]:fromdatetimeimporttimedeltaIn[2]:td=timedelta(hours=2)In[3]:str(td)Out[3]:'2:00:00'我想做的是从它的字符串表示中重新创建一个timedelta对象。然而,据我所知,datetime.parser.parse方法将始终返回一个datetime.datetime对象(参见https://dateutil.readthedocs.io/en/stable/parser.html):In[4]:importdateutil.

Python:如何修改/编辑打印到屏幕上的字符串并读回?

我想在Windows中将字符串打印到命令行/终端,然后编辑/更改字符串并读回。任何人都知道该怎么做?谢谢print"Hell"Hello! 最佳答案 您可以做一些ANSI技巧,让它看起来像是在屏幕上编辑。Checkoutthislink(也类似于thisSOpostoncolors)。这只适用于某些终端和配置。嗯嗯。这个python脚本在我的Win7Cygwin终端中运行:print'hell'print'\033[1A\033[4CO!'最终在一行打印hellO!。第二次打印将光标向上移动一行(Esc[1A),然后超过4个字符(E

python - 清理一列字符串并添加新列的更有效方法

我有一个数据框df,其中包含列['metric_type','metric_value']。对于每一行,我想确保我有一个名称等于'metric_type'且该列的值等于'metric_value'的列。我的一个问题是'metric_type'有我想去掉的虚假空格。考虑数据框df:df=pd.DataFrame([['a',1],['b',2],['c',3]],columns=['metric_type','metric_value'])print(df)metric_typemetric_value0a11b22c3请注意,'metric_type'的每个值在不同的地方都有空格。我创

python - 遍历unicode字符串并与python字典中的unicode进行比较

我有两个python词典,其中包含有关日语单词和字符的信息:vocabDic:包含词汇表,键:单词,值:包含相关信息的字典kanjiDic:包含汉字(单个日文字符),键:汉字,值:包含相关信息的字典现在我想遍历vocabDic中每个单词的每个字符,并在汉字字典中查找这个字符。我的目标是创建一个csv文件,然后我可以将其作为词汇表和汉字的连接表导入到数据库中。我的Python版本是2.6我的代码如下:kanjiVocabJoinWriter=csv.writer(open('kanjiVocabJoin.csv','wb'),delimiter=',',quotechar='|',quo